본문 바로가기

Back-end

(48)
DB 종류별 장단점 - Oracle 오라클은 충분한 큰 예산과 복잡한 비즈니스 요구와 기업 고객을 위해 설계되었습니다. 대규모 다중 사용자 온라인 롤 플레잉 게임을 관리합니다. 수백만 명의 플레이어가 동시에 사용할 때도 응답 시간 면에서 매우 최적화되어 있습니다. - MySQL MySQL은 가장 일반적으로 데이터베이스 기반 웹 사이트 및 Non-Critical 애플리케이션에 사용되는 저가의 데이터베이스입니다. 오픈 소스 라이센스 덕분에 MySQL은 웹 사이트, 전자 상거래, 로깅 응용 프로그램 등에 매우 대중적이고 널리 사용되었습니다. 오픈 소스 DB이기 때문에 정확히 무슨 일이 일어나고 있는지에 대한 전체 내부를 제공합니다. - Microsoft SQL Server Microsoft SQL Server는 트랜잭션 처리, ..
[MySQL] Join 깔끔한 이해와 사용법 상단의 그림 정말 정리가 잘 되어 있습니다. 처음 접할 때 보고도 저게뭔가 싶었는데 초심자의 입장에서 이해하기 쉽도록 설명해보려합니다. 1. LEFT JOIN A, B 테이블 중에 A값의 전체와, A의 KEY 값과 B KEY 값이 같은 결과를 리턴 무슨말인가 싶다.. 그냥 눈으로 보고 이해하자. 필자는 글로 이해하는게 너무 싫음 A라는 테이블을 보자 B라는 테이블을 보자 이 두 테이블이 각 A와 B 집합이라고 하자 이중에서 우리는 두 테이블 ID값으로 A와 B의 LEFT JOIN을 실행해 볼 것이다. A LEFT JOIN B 는 위에올라가서 다시 보자 A값의 전체와, A의 KEY 값과 B KEY 값이 같은 결과를 리턴 결과를 예상해보자 어떤결과일까? A의 ID값과 B의 ID값이 같은 값이 연결되고 ID가..
MySQL by Traversy Media MySQL Cheat Sheet Help with SQL commands to interact with a MySQL database MySQL Locations Mac /usr/local/mysql/bin Windows /Program Files/MySQL/MySQL version/bin Xampp /xampp/mysql/bin Add mysql to your PATH # Current Session export PATH=${PATH}:/usr/local/mysql/bin # Permanantly echo 'export PATH="/usr/local/mysql/bin:$PATH"' >> ~/.bash_profile On Windows - https://www.qualitestgroup.com/resou..
MySQL 실행창 갑자기 꺼져버리는 현상 해결 https://eboong.tistory.com/62 MySQL 실행창이 갑자기 꺼져버리는 현상.. 해결방법은? 블로거 여니입니다! 오늘은 mysql에 관한 포스팅을 해보려고 해요. DB를 사용하려고 MySQL 실행창을 클릭했는데 갑자기 실행창이 빛의속도로 사라지더라구요? 제가 일부러 창을 닫은것도 아닌데 말 eboong.tistory.com
MySQL 에러해결 : cannot connect to database server https://dhan-description.tistory.com/84 [DBMS] MySQL - Cannot Connect to Database Server 해결방법 MySQL Workbench를 통해 DB에 접근 시 위 와 같은 오류가 발생한다면 다음과 같이 조치합니다. 1. 작업표시줄(시작 메뉴)에서 서비스 검색 및 실행 2. MySQL을 찾아 서비스를 중지합니다. 3. my.ini파일을 dhan-description.tistory.com https://mondaysickness.com/2019/11/01/mysql-workbench-%EC%A0%91%EC%86%8D-%EC%95%88%EB%90%A0-%EB%95%8C-%ED%95%B4%EA%B2%B0-%EB%B0%A9%EB%B2%95-your-co..
Spring & Hibernate for Beginners 수료 스프링 개념을 이해하기위해 공부했던 Spring & Hibernate 코스를 마무리했다 전체적인 개념을 이해하고 실제 코드설명을 들으며 코딩하니 이해가 잘 되었고 흐름을 잡는데 큰 도움이 된거같다. 꽤나 긴 강의였는데, 끝내고나니 섭섭한 마음이 앞선다 4달정도 매일 수업을 시간내서 수강한것같다.
React - Spring Boot Toy Project (1) 가장 만들고 싶었던 Spring boot + React 프로젝트를 드디어 시작하게 되었다. 그 동안 공부한 Spring REST API, Spring Data JPA를 활용해볼 수 있을것 같다. React도 백엔드에서 api를 받아 어떻게 페이지를 구성하는 공부할 것이다. 먼저 start.spring.io/에서 start파일을 구성한다. 위에 구성을 체크하여 받아준다. 사용하는 IDE에서 파일을 열어준다. Package 를 생성하고난 후 User Class를 생성한다. package com.myapp.springboot.model; import javax.persistence.*; @Entity @Table(name = "users") public class User { @Id @GeneratedValu..
Spring boot - Angular Project (2) 1. dao package를 생성한다. 2. 인터페이스를 생성한다. - ProductCategoryRepository package com.luv2code.ecommerce.dao; import com.luv2code.ecommerce.entity.Product; import org.springframework.data.jpa.repository.JpaRepository; import org.springframework.web.bind.annotation.CrossOrigin; @CrossOrigin("http://localhost:4200") public interface ProductRepository extends JpaRepository { } JpaRepostitory의 Product는 Enti..